Elon Musk's SpaceX and Italy's Unipol join forces to help Italians hit by flooding

Cruel rains have thrashed the Emilia Romagna region of Italy, and when the clouds refused to retreat, our brave Italian firefighters became lifelines, delivering sustenance to those stranded in their homes. But, that's not all folks, another lifeline is on the way and it's beaming down from space!
SpaceX, Elon Musk's space exploration titan, and Unipol Gruppo, Italy's trusted insurer, have struck a deal to ensure the flood-stricken locals aren't left in the dark. Their mission? Bring the internet back to the people. Why? To turbo-charge the rescue ops!

The weather's fury has claimed 14 lives, devastated agriculture, and caused billions of euros worth of damage in Emilia-Romagna. With over 36,000 locals forced to abandon their homes and power outages plunging regions into darkness, it's been a relentless battle for the rescuers.

Thanks to this daring alliance, Unipol will get their hands on SpaceX's Starlink internet terminals. Their job? To plug rescuers, hospitals, and the public back into the digital world, providing much-needed communication lines. And SpaceX? They're realigning their satellites to prioritize coverage over the beleaguered Italian region.
"SpaceX, Starlink, and Tesla are happy to be of use in any way to help Italy and the people affected by the flooding", Musk said in a statement.
